The Shell Petroleum Development Company of Nigeria Limited - We hereby announce the commencement of the 2015/2016 Sabbatical Attachment Programmes
Sabbatical Attachment for University Lectures
Duration: 12 months (non renewable)
Job Description
- The sabbatical programme offers University lecturers an opportunity to undertake research that would contribute to Shell Exploration and Production Companies in Nigeria (SEPCiN), while offering them avenues to acquire industry-related experience.
- The programme also offers opportunities for lectureship at the Centre of Excellence in Geosciences and Petroleum Engineering at the University of Benin in the following disciplines: Petroleum Geology Geophysics and, Petroleum Engineering.
Discipline Areas
- Environment (Environmental Monitoring Restoration, Biodiversity and Impact Management);
- NGO/Corporate Communication, information & Impact Management, Sustainable Community Development;
- Obstetrics & Gynecology, Pediatrics & Public Health, Occupational Health.
Position Requirements
- Senior lecturers and above (Candidates who will be over 60 years by January 2, 2016 need not apply)
